Top Locations Tagged with Ravechi hotel

Ravechi hotel in India - 360004/ near rajkot/ near rajkot

Ravechi hotel in India - 360110/ near jamnagar

Ravechi hotel in India - 383316/ near sabarkatha

Ravechi hotel in India - 360003/ near rajkot